April 8, 2016-The Emporia State women made quick work of Ft. Hays State to snap a four dual losing streak and improve to 10-8 on the season.
The Hornets only dropped three games in the doubles competition as they took a 3-0 lead into singles. Amy Fugit got a 6-0, 6-1 win at #3 singles and Lori Ahuja won 6-1, 6-2 at #4 to clinch the dual for Emporia State.
It was the first time in three duals that Emporia State had a full complement of players.
The Hornets are back in action on Saturday when both the men and women take on Neb.-Kearney at the EHS Courts.
